StructureScan® 3D provides a new and easy way to view and interpret StructureScan® HD Imaging data.

Navico 3D

  • Navico 3D is a multi-beam 3D Clear Imaging™ sonar technology that produces captivating images with stunning detail.
  • The true-to-life 3D scans are displayed on the Lowrance HDS Gen 3 series of fishfinder/chartplotters.
  • The 3D images of the underwater terrain and fish-holding structure beneath your boat form in real time, as they come into view.
  • This 3D Clear Imaging™ sonar technology quickly converts scans into high-resolution, 180-degree wide, three-dimensional views.

Easier Visualization

  • 3D visualizations can be viewed from any angle with ScanTrack™ pan-tilt-rotate control using on-screen touch gestures and easy-to-use, preset viewing positions. 

Master The Bottom Line

  • For the first time, StructureScan® 3D allows anglers to easily see all underwater fish-holding structure and the fish as if they were fishing underwater. 
  • Eliminate confusion when fish aren’t on the banks and in shallow, visible cover.
  • Now, a slow idle over a potential area quickly lets you master bottom contours, identify a vertical break or secondary point, and catch more fish in and near the main deep water channel.

Many enthusiast rides post strong sales in 2010

Wed, 05 Jan 2011

The fast and the luxurious models from a wide range of carmakers sold briskly in 2010, offering heart to enthusiasts that their favorite drives have bright outlooks and that the auto business is on the rebound. Let's start with the muscle cars: As predicted in December, Chevrolet's Camaro sales topped the Ford Mustang's numbers for the first time in 25 years. In the Camaro's first full year since production ended after the 2002 model year, Chevy rung up 81,299 Camaro sales, beating Mustang by 7,583 cars.

First 2014 Shelby GT500 Super Snake headed to museum

Thu, 30 Jan 2014

The first 2014 Ford Shelby GT500 Super Snake was delivered to the new Shelby Automotive Museum in Southern California on Dec. 26, 2013. The 850-hp, Grabber Blue pony car wearing chassis number 14SS0010 will take its place among the rest of Shelby’s classics, and it will also join the Shelby Registry.

Driven: Citroen DS3

Wed, 30 Mar 2011

The Citroën DS3's success has taken many – Citroën included – by surprise. The company has been forced to increase production since the car went on sale 12 months ago, in the light of unprecedented customer appetite. At launch, there were many who felt the DS3's relatively conventional nature did a gross disservice to the famous nameplate (despite the company's protestations that the DS moniker has no connection with its 50s namesake).
